(a) Except as provided in subsection (b) of this section, if a holder violates any provision of this subtitle, no holder may collect or receive any finance charge from the buyer.
(b)(1) If the seller or any subsequent holder unintentionally and in good faith fails to comply with any provision of §§ 12-504 through 12-507 of this subtitle, the holder may correct the error within 10 days after:
(i) He notices it; or
(ii) The buyer notifies him in writing of the error.
(2) If the holder corrects the error within the 10-day period, he may not be subject to any penalty under this subtitle.
